    An analysis of aircraft accidents involving fires

    All U. S. Air Carrier accidents between 1963 and 1974 were studied to assess the extent of total personnel and aircraft damage which occurred in accidents and in accidents involving fire. Published accident reports and NTSB investigators' factual backup files were the primary sources of data. Although it was frequently not possible to assess the relative extent of fire-caused damage versus impact damage using the available data, the study established upper and lower bounds for deaths and damage due specifically to fire. In 12 years there were 122 accidents which involved airframe fires. Eighty-seven percent of the fires occurred after impact, and fuel leakage from ruptured tanks or severed lines was the most frequently cited cause. A cost analysis was performed for 300 serious accidents, including 92 serious accidents which involved fire. Personal injury costs were outside the scope of the cost analysis, but data on personnel injury judgements as well as settlements received from the CAB are included for reference

    Modeling, simulation, and control of an extraterrestrial oxygen production plant

    The immediate objective is the development of a new methodology for simulation of process plants used to produce oxygen and/or other useful materials from local planetary resources. Computer communication, artificial intelligence, smart sensors, and distributed control algorithms are being developed and implemented so that the simulation or an actual plant can be controlled from a remote location. The ultimate result of this research will provide the capability for teleoperation of such process plants which may be located on Mars, Luna, an asteroid, or other objects in space. A very useful near-term result will be the creation of an interactive design tool, which can be used to create and optimize the process/plant design and the control strategy. This will also provide a vivid, graphic demonstration mechanism to convey the results of other researchers to the sponsor

    Stanley Hauerwas\u27 Approach to Christian Marital and Sex Ethics: A Review and Speculative Expansion

    Few places in congregational and denominational life are more fraught with tension and division than conversations about marital and sex ethics. Systemic abuses mingled together with individual failures on this issue has led to confusion, conflict, and chaos. Worse yet, the remedies proposed—and they are many—tend to either double down on “Traditional” values or seek massive reformation of Christian convictions in light of Modern philosophical, anthropological, and sociological presuppositions. Interlocutors quickly come to an impasse and fragmentation occurs. The catalyst for these conflicts is often debates over same-sex marriage, but one does not have to wade far into this conversation to discover that the issues run deeper than this single topic. This dissertation emerges from a conviction that this doesn’t have to be the story of the Protestant church in America in late-20th and early-21st century culture. The opportunity to reclaim Christian unity while maintaining a unique understanding of marriage and sex, which creates inclusive space for same-sex oriented Christians, is possible. To get there, though, the shackles of so many faulty assumptions about this topic will have to fall off and those previously bound will have to embrace the liberty offered them in a shared Christian narrative, community, and character. It is precisely these themes that theological ethicist, Stanley Hauerwas, has spent a career elucidating and it is through a Hauerwasian approach that this dissertation hopes to correct the church’s current broken proclamation and damaged practices of marriage and sex

    Information Systems and Healthcare XXXVII: When Your Employer Provides Your Personal Health Record—Exploring Employee Perceptions of an Employer-Sponsored PHR System

    A growing number of employers provide electronic personal health records (PHRs) as a service to employees as part of a health benefit program. However, a variety of unique issues related to attitudes and adoption arise when a PHR is hosted by the employer, and little research has addressed this relationship. This article reports the findings from an exploratory study of factors that influence employee perceptions, concerns, and expectations related to an employer—sponsored PHR service, with data from 132 employees of a large U.S. corporation. Attitudes toward PHR systems and employee perceptions and concerns identified in prior research are evaluated. Despite studies suggesting significant demand for PHR products across the general public, especially those that are offered at no cost to the user, responses indicated unique barriers to use, as well as opportunities, for employer-sponsored PHRs. The future role of employers as sponsors of PHRs is discussed in light of obstacles and strategies to improve system use, and the need to help employees realize the potential value of employer-sponsored PHRs

    Summer Precipitation Predicts Spatial Distributions of Semiaquatic Mammals

Plos One, 10(8), 14. doi:10.1371/journal.pone.0135036Climate change is predicted to increase the frequency of droughts and intensity of seasonal precipitation in many regions. Semiaquatic mammals should be vulnerable to this increased variability in precipitation, especially in human-modified landscapes where dispersal to suitable habitat or temporary refugia may be limited. Using six years of presence-absence data (2007-2012) spanning years of record-breaking drought and flood conditions, we evaluated regional occupancy dynamics of American mink (Neovison vison) and muskrats (Ondatra zibethicus) in a highly altered agroecosystem in Illinois, USA. We used noninvasive sign surveys and a multiseason occupancy modeling approach to estimate annual occupancy rates for both species and related these rates to summer precipitation. We also tracked radiomarked individuals to assess mortality risk for both species when moving in terrestrial areas. Annual model-averaged estimates of occupancy for mink and muskrat were correlated positively to summer precipitation. Mink and muskrats were widespread during a year (2008) with above-average precipitation. However, estimates of site occupancy declined substantially for mink (0.56) and especially muskrats (0.09) during the severe drought of 2012. Mink are generalist predators that probably use terrestrial habitat during droughts. However, mink had substantially greater risk of mortality away from streams. In comparison, muskrats are more restricted to aquatic habitats and likely suffered high mortality during the drought. Our patterns are striking, but a more mechanistic understanding is needed of how semiaquatic species in human-modified ecosystems will respond ecologically in situ to extreme weather events predicted by climate-change models

    Diabetes mellitus and hyperglycemia control on the risk of colorectal adenomatous polyps: a retrospective cohort study

    BACKGROUND: Colorectal cancer (CRC) develops from colorectal adenomatous polyps. This study is to determine if diabetes mellitus (DM), its treatment, and hemoglobin A1c (HbA1c) level are associated with increased risk of colorectal adenomatous polyps. METHODS: This was a retrospective cohort study that included patients who had at least one colonoscopy and were continuously enrolled in a single managed care organization during a 10-year period (2002-2012). Of these patients (N = 11,933), 1800 were randomly selected for chart review to examine the details of colonoscopy and pathology findings and to confirm the diagnosis of DM. Multivariable logistic regression analyses were performed to assess the associations between DM, its treatment, HbA1c level and adenomatous polyps (our main outcome). RESULTS: Among the total of 11,933 patients with a mean (standard deviation) age of 56 (± 8.8) years, 2306 (19.3%) had DM and 75 (0.6%) had CRC. Among the 1800 under chart review, 445 (24.7%) had DM, 11 (0.6%) had CRC and 537 (29.8%) had adenomatous polyps. In bivariate analysis, patients with DM had 1.45 odds of developing adenomatous polyps compared to those without DM. This effect was attenuated (odds ratio = 1.25, 95% CI: 0.96-1.62, p = 0.09) after adjusting for confounders such as age, gender, race/ethnicity, and body mass index. There was no significant association between type or duration of DM treatment or HbA1c level and adenomatous polyps. CONCLUSIONS: Our study confirmed the known increased risk of adenomatous polyps with advancing age, male gender, Hispanic race/ethnicity and higher body mass index. Although it suggested an association between DM and adenomatous polyps, a statistically significant association was not observed after controlling for other potential confounders. Further studies with a larger sample size are needed to further elucidate this relationship
